Mute Thy Coronation Poem by Emily Dickinson

Mute Thy Coronation

Rating: 5.0


151

Mute thy Coronation—
Meek my Vive le roi,
Fold a tiny courtier
In thine Ermine, Sir,
There to rest revering
Till the pageant by,
I can murmur broken,
Master, It was I—
